Product Details of Logitech Cordless Desktop S 510

Description

The Cordless Desktop S 510 is a perfect match with today's flat screen systems. Its innovative flatter keyboard design gives you a consistent desktop look as well as an amazingly high level of comfort. Relax your wrists on the built-in palm rest, and with one touch, you can navigate the web or shuffle for a random music mix. Scroll pages vertically and horizontally with the optical mouse with tilt wheel, and you can use it continuously for 6 months or more with the longer battery life. Enjoy one-touch image zooming, and cool media features such as handy rotation of digital pictures. Launch applications with the programmable F-keys. An advanced optical mouse delivers fast, consistent performance and more freedom of movement.

Reviews on Logitech Cordless Desktop S 510

  • 4
  By member: mredmon - May 28, 2006

Great Looking Keyboard/Mouse Combo

Strengths: Low Profile Easy to hit keys (low depth to trigger keypress) Good build quality (feels sturdy) Side-scrolling mouse (good for nagivating forward/backward in firefox) Non-obtrusive media buttons

Weakness: Non-rechargeable kit (though I use rechargeables in it) Mouse doesn't have enough buttons to do side-scrolling AND navigating

I have been using this keyboard for three days now and love it. It has the low-profile look to it of the high-end Di Novo products but a very low-end price. It has low-depth keys, making it easier to type fast (you don't have to press down as far). The feel of the overall unit is excellent, especially compared to the Logitech Cordless Elite Duo that it is replacing... much sturdier. And finally,...

  • 4
  By member: atdave - Jan 30, 2006

S510

Strengths: stylish, thin, wireless, programmable keys

Weakness: average mouse

this is a great desktop set for the money. logitech has never let me down. the keyboard is very thin and light, and the keys are a lot like a laptop... quiet with a short, smooth stroke. comes with batteries and has excellent wireless signal. the only downside is the mouse is nothing special. it's not bad, but they could have easily thrown in something better. at least it works for both righties...
